The answer to this is you always post based on your own valuations. Then you negotiate the contract based on your own valuations colored by leverage at play. If you do not end up coming to terms with the player he doesn't get to play ball in the US this year. You do not gain anything by simply shrugging and sighing "someone else is going to bid more so why bother", except for the obvious situation where you value someone like Yu Darvish at a $10 MM bid (in which case it isn't worth the internal effort to go through the motions).

I believe casual fans care about the aggregate effort. Pointing to one bid and saying "see we tried" is irrelevant if the totality of the off-season is a failure to improve the club. Likewise, if you make some moves and go into next season with a good faith effort to compete, the casual fan isn't going to care whether you participated in a particular closed auction.
